Gyógyászok
Gyógyászok is a Hungarian term that translates to "healers" or "curers." Historically, it referred to individuals who practiced traditional folk medicine, often relying on natural remedies, spiritual beliefs, and inherited knowledge. These individuals played a vital role in rural communities, providing healthcare services where formal medical access was limited. Their practices encompassed a wide range of ailments, from common colds and digestive issues to more serious conditions, and often involved herbal concoctions, poultices, massage, and sometimes even spiritual or ritualistic elements.
